Trail Description:
The Penokee Mountain Ski Trail is located in the snow belt of Lake Superior. The trail is located on the north edge of a valley providing spectacular views of the surrounding area. An overlook adjacent to the parking lot provides great views of the valley. In spite of being located in rugged terrain, the trail is suitable for skiers of moderate ability. Only the 8.6 Km loop has climbs and down hills that demand intermediate skiing ability. The trail is groomed and tracked for classic technique skiing. Because of the lake effect snow, this trail has some of the earliest skiing on the Great Divide Ranger District.
Specific Hiking and Trail Information for the Penokee Mountain Trail
Location of the Penokee Mountain Trail: Chequamegon Side
Length of Trail: Over 10 miles
Estimated Difficulty (Forest Service Estimate): Easy:Intermediate
Travel Information
Trailhead Directions: From Mellen, drive 3 miles west on State Highway GG. The parking lot is on the right (north) side of the road.
